ELMHURST, IL – After a dispute, an Elmhurst resident banged on a neighbor's door and yelled at him, authorities said.

The incident occurred about 3:30 p.m. Friday in the 500 block of South Mitchell Avenue, police said. A report was filed Sunday.

The targeted neighbor did not press charges, police said. The incident was listed as disorderly conduct.
